Corsica's interior is as captivating as its coastline, with dramatic granite gorges, prehistoric standing stones at Filitosa, and Napoleon's birthplace in Ajaccio sitting alongside the clifftop citadels of Bonifacio and Calvi.
The island's beaches, from the white sands of Palombaggia to the secluded cove at Girolata, are matched by a rugged interior made for hiking, canyoning, and wine touring through centuries-old vineyards. A yacht charter in Corsica is the ideal way to explore this varied island, reaching remote anchorages along the Scandola Nature Reserve's volcanic coastline that are otherwise inaccessible.
